The street in brief

Osborne Avenue is a street almost entirely of semi-detached houses. Homes here typically change hands around £205,000 — roughly 11% above the CH45 norm. Recent sales are too thin to call a trend for the street itself; CH45 prices as a whole have been rising. With 5 sales across 4 homes since 2000, homes here come to market only rarely.
